Payment Methods Customized for domestic Players

LuckyCapone stocks its cashier with banking methods Canadians prefer. Visa and Mastercard are the trusted choices. Using a credit or debit card adds funds right away, but ask your bank, as some treat casino deposits as cash advances. The favorite for many is Interac e-Transfer. It taps directly into Canada’s financial system. You transfer funds from your online banking quickly using a secure email transfer. For a more modern approach, e-wallets like MuchBetter and Jeton work well. You link your bank account or card to the wallet once, then make one-click deposits. This also maintains your main bank details confidential from the casino. The majority of deposits are happens instantly, and you can often start with as little as $10 or $20 CAD.

Authentication Process for Secure Payments

Before your first payout, LuckyCapone must confirm your identity. All reputable casinos performs this. It’s not just a formality; it’s a essential requirement that prevents scams, minor gambling, and money laundering. You’ll need to upload documentation using a protected upload interface. Typically, this means a photo of your identification (like a driver’s license or passport), a recent document that confirms your residence (like a utility bill), and occasionally a picture of the debit card you used. It might feel like a hassle, but it’s a one-off step that renders the entire casino safer for all players. Get it done right after you register. Thus when you hit a win, nothing is blocking your payout. The platform handles all these documents with high security.

Transaction Timelines and Management Guidelines

Being aware of what to expect, and at what time, assists reduce frustration. At LuckyCapone, each withdrawal request passes a verification step at the outset. This is where the casino’s team checks the transaction against their rules and your account history. It typically takes up to 24 hours. After they give the okay, the clock begins for your selected payment method. E-wallets are fast, often landing in your account in 12 to 48 hours. Interac and bank transfers go through external banking systems, which can add another 3 to 5 business days. LuckyCapone tries to be prompt, but note that your own bank or e-wallet provider can create delays, especially on weekends. You can monitor every step of any transaction in your account history on the site.
